Shopping

In West India, visit the Phoenix Marketcity for a blend of international brands and local boutiques. Explore the vibrant Colaba Causeway for unique souvenirs, handicrafts, and street fashion. Don't miss the bustling Crawford Market, where you can find spices, textiles, and traditional Indian artefacts.

Adventure

In Goa, experience thrilling water sports like parasailing and jet skiing along the stunning coastline. In Maharashtra, trek up to the majestic forts of the Western Ghats for breathtaking views and rich history. For a unique adventure, explore the wildlife sanctuaries in Gujarat, home to diverse flora and fauna.

Nightlife

West India's nightlife pulses with vibrant energy. Explore the lively beaches of Goa, where beach shacks serve cocktails and host DJ nights. In Mumbai, visit Colaba for chic rooftop bars and lively dance clubs, while Pune offers a mix of pubs with live music and trendy lounges.

What are some of the general tips for travellers to West India during the COVID-19 outbreak?
With new restrictions and safety precautions to follow, travel looks a bit different at the moment. These are some helpful things to know before you fly off to West India:
  • Before locking in your flight, find out if any travel bans or restrictions apply — in both your origin and destination. Keep informed with the latest updates by checking government travel advisories.
  • Wear a face mask during airport screening. A TSA officer will require you to adjust your mask for identification purposes.
  • To reduce the risk of cross-contamination, position your boarding pass on the reader yourself and then hold it up for inspection. Do not hand your boarding pass directly to a TSA agent.
  • You can now take one container of hand sanitizer up to 12 oz (350 ml) in your carry-on luggage. This will need to be taken out for X-ray scanning.
  • Remove items from your pocket, like your keys, phone and wallet, and put them in your carry-on rather than the bins. This will reduce handling during screening.
  • If you're planning to take food through security screening, put it in a clear plastic bag and then into a screening bin. This reduces the likelihood that a TSA employee will need to touch your food container or carry-on bag for closer inspection.
